This restaurant is a godsend for the village of La Chapelle Montbrandeix, just like the guinguette (riverside café) or the solitary grocery store. The welcome is warm and the food is good.
At lunchtime, the set menu is simply perfect: generous and refined. There are few dishes on the à la carte menu, but all are very well executed. I recommend the pressed crispy beef chuck, pan-seared foie gras, and rich jus served with carrot purée. A truly excellent place.
